WebThe farthest distance from the Sun to Jupiter is – 816.36 million km. The closest distance between the Sun and Jupiter is – 740.60 million km. Web11 apr. 2024 · Jupiter's icy moons are so far from the Sun that astronomers have long excluded them from the area of the solar system considered habitable. Their major asset: sheltering under their ice surface oceans of liquid water - only water in the liquid state makes life possible. The Sol-Jupiter barycenter sits 1.07 times the radius of the sun from the sun's center, or 7 percent the radius of the sun from the surface.

Mars is about 1.5 times further from the sun as compared to … WebIf Jupiter had Mercury's orbit (57,900,000 km, 0.387 AU), the Sun–Jupiter barycenter would be approximately 55,000 km from the center of the Sun (r 1 / R 1 ≈ 0.08). But even if the Earth had Eris 's orbit (1.02 × 10 10 km, 68 AU), the Sun–Earth barycenter would still be within the Sun (just over 30,000 km from the center).
